ALTER USER 'username'@'host' IDENTIFIED BY 'newpassword';
语句。
在DedeCMS(织梦内容管理系统)中,修改数据库密码是一个涉及多个步骤的过程,旨在确保系统的安全性和稳定性,以下是详细的步骤说明:
1、备份数据:在进行任何密码修改操作之前,务必先备份网站文件和数据库,这可以防止在修改过程中出现意外情况导致数据丢失,你可以使用FTP工具下载网站文件,并使用phpMyAdmin等数据库管理工具导出数据库。
2、确认当前密码:在进行密码修改之前,需要确认当前的数据库密码,如果忘记了当前密码,可以通过以下方法找回或重置。
1、找到配置文件:DedeCMS的数据库配置文件通常位于网站根目录下的/data/common.inc.php
文件中。
2、编辑配置文件:使用FTP或其他文件管理工具,找到并下载common.inc.php
文件到本地电脑,或者直接在服务器上编辑,用文本编辑器打开该文件,找到类似以下的代码部分:
$dbhost = 'localhost';
$dbuser = '数据库用户名';
$dbpass = '旧的数据库密码';
$dbname = '数据库名';
3、修改密码:将$dbpass
的值修改为新的数据库密码。
$dbpass = '新的数据库密码';
4、保存并上传文件:保存修改后的common.inc.php
文件,并通过FTP工具或文件管理器上传回服务器,替换原有文件。
1、使用phpMyAdmin
登录phpMyAdmin:通过浏览器访问phpMyAdmin,输入MySQL用户名和密码登录。
选择数据库:在左侧的导航栏中选择与DedeCMS相关的数据库。
找到用户表:点击顶部的“用户”选项卡,找到用于存储用户信息的表,通常表名为dede_admin
或类似名称。
修改用户密码:找到管理员账户,在密码字段中输入新的密码,注意:密码通常需要经过MD5加密,因此在保存前需要对新密码进行MD5加密,你可以使用在线工具或编写简单的脚本来生成MD5加密后的密码。
执行SQL语句:在查询窗口中输入以下SQL语句,并点击“执行”按钮完成密码更新:
UPDATE dede_admin SET pwd=MD5('新密码') WHERE userid='管理员ID';
请将“新密码”替换为你实际想要设置的新密码,将“管理员ID”替换为对应的管理员账号ID。
2、使用命令行
连接到服务器:通过SSH连接到服务器。
登录MySQL命令行:输入以下命令登录MySQL命令行(请将“root”替换为你的MySQL root用户名):
mysql -u root -p
选择数据库:输入以下命令选择要使用的数据库(请将“database_name”替换为你的数据库名称):
USE database_name;
修改密码:输入以下命令修改数据库用户的密码(请将“username”替换为数据库用户名,将“new_password”替换为新密码):
ALTER USER 'username'@'localhost' IDENTIFIED BY 'new_password';
刷新权限:输入以下命令使更改生效:
FLUSH PRIVILEGES;
1、测试网站功能:修改完数据库密码和配置文件后,访问DedeCMS网站,确保所有功能正常运行,如果出现数据库连接错误,检查配置文件和数据库密码是否匹配。
2、查看日志文件:查看DedeCMS的错误日志文件,确保没有与数据库连接相关的错误,如果有错误,重新检查并确保所有配置和密码正确无误。
1、定期更改密码:为了增强安全性,建议定期更改数据库密码,并确保密码足够复杂,包含字母、数字和特殊字符。
2、备份数据库:在更改数据库密码之前,建议先备份数据库,以防出现意外情况导致数据丢失。
3、使用安全连接:确保数据库连接使用SSL等加密方式,防止数据在传输过程中被截获。
1、我忘记了DedeCMS的数据库密码,应该如何进行修改?
如果你忘记了DedeCMS的数据库密码,可以通过以下步骤进行修改:按照上述步骤登录phpMyAdmin或其他数据库管理工具;找到DedeCMS所使用的数据库和用户表;在用户表中将密码字段更新为新的密码(记得使用MD5加密)。
2、如何通过DedeCMS后台管理系统修改数据库密码?
DedeCMS后台管理系统本身并不提供直接修改数据库密码的功能,你需要按照上述步骤手动修改数据库配置文件和数据库中的实际密码。
修改DedeCMS的数据库密码是一项重要的安全措施,但也需要谨慎操作,在修改过程中,请务必备份好数据和配置文件,以免因误操作导致数据丢失或网站无法正常运行,建议定期更新密码并采取其他安全措施来保护你的网站安全。